There have been some really great photo opportunities of the moon lately. Above is the crescent moon in the western sky just after sunset. Directly below is of the full moon in the eastern sky just before sunset, and the third shot is of the lunar eclipse in the eastern sky at sunrise.
There is a really great mountain right out my backdoor that I love to photograph. Above is during a full moon that lit up the mountain beautifully. I have an angle looking west towards it, so it often gets interesting colors during sunset on cloudy days.
I woke up early on a day off to find low hovering clouds that seemed more suited for the pacific northwest. A very interesting thing to see out here in the desert.
I have been seeing a lot of big horn sheep lately, but haven't been able to get too many photos. Some things are nice to just sit back and enjoy.
